VMCI: Fix some error handling paths in vmci_guest_probe_device()

The 'err_remove_vmci_dev_g' error label is not at the right place.
This could lead to un-released resource.

There is also a missing label. If pci_alloc_irq_vectors() fails, the
previous vmci_event_subscribe() call must be undone.
